Description
Desiccant Masterbatch is a new type of functional masterbatch specially developed to solve the moisture problems. With a small adding rate, by mixing with the raw materials, it absorbs the moisture during the production process, no need to dry material anymore, thus saving the drying process.
Product Model: PE200
Life time: 24 hours after open bag
Adding rate: 1-10% depends on the water/moisture volumn. Usually 2%
Further Information:
Plastic Water Absorber, Desiccant Masterbatch, takes inorganic functional material compound with plastic carrier as its raw material and produced by new high technologies. Compared with market Desiccant Masterbatch, tt has good dispersion, no mesh jam and strong stability features.
